#547 - Haudenosaunee Women's Lacrosse Team Disbanded

For several decades the male dominated power structure in Onondaga has tried to keep Haudenosaunee women out of lacrosse in order to maintain their dominance over the Iroquois Nationals men's lacrosse team. After facing pressure from lucrative sponsors and outside organizations to merge the two teams under one banner, a delegation from the men's team spoke to the Grand Council of Six Nations at an unusual closed-door session and the women's team was disbanded without justification shortly after. The women were not given an opportunity to defend themselves and their team's sanction was pulled by the Grand Council which made it impossible for them to compete at the international level. In this episode, John is joined by Katie Smith, Erin Francis and Kathy Smith to peel back the curtain on the inner-workings of Haudenosaunee politics and to discuss these troubling developments. →→→→ Like what you hear?
